数据库 · 6 11 月, 2024

南郵數據庫實驗一:數據建模與SQL查詢 (南郵數據庫實驗一)

南郵數據庫實驗一:數據建模與SQL查詢

在當今數據驅動的世界中,數據庫的設計與管理變得越來越重要。南郵數據庫實驗一專注於數據建模與SQL查詢,這是學習數據庫管理系統(DBMS)的一個重要步驟。本文將探討數據建模的基本概念、SQL查詢的基本語法,以及如何在實際應用中運用這些知識。

數據建模的基本概念

數據建模是將業務需求轉化為數據結構的過程。它通常包括以下幾個步驟:

  • 需求分析:了解業務需求,確定需要存儲的數據類型。
  • 概念模型:使用實體-關係圖(ER圖)來表示數據之間的關係。
  • 邏輯模型:根據概念模型設計邏輯結構,確定數據表及其屬性。
  • 物理模型:根據邏輯模型設計具體的數據庫結構,包括索引、約束等。

例如,假設我們要設計一個簡單的圖書管理系統,我們可能會有以下幾個實體:

  • 書籍(Book)
  • 作者(Author)
  • 讀者(Reader)

這些實體之間的關係可以用ER圖表示,書籍與作者之間是一對多的關係,而讀者與書籍之間則是多對多的關係。

SQL查詢的基本語法

SQL(結構化查詢語言)是用於與數據庫進行交互的標準語言。以下是一些基本的SQL查詢語法:

1. 創建數據表


CREATE TABLE Books (
    BookID INT PRIMARY KEY,
    Title VARCHAR(100),
    AuthorID INT,
    FOREIGN KEY (AuthorID) REFERENCES Authors(AuthorID)
);

2. 插入數據


INSERT INTO Books (BookID, Title, AuthorID) VALUES (1, '數據庫系統概論', 1);

3. 查詢數據


SELECT * FROM Books WHERE AuthorID = 1;

4. 更新數據


UPDATE Books SET Title = '數據庫系統' WHERE BookID = 1;

5. 刪除數據


DELETE FROM Books WHERE BookID = 1;

這些基本的SQL操作可以幫助用戶有效地管理數據庫中的數據。通過這些查詢,使用者可以輕鬆地進行數據的增刪改查,從而滿足業務需求。

實驗的應用與意義

南郵數據庫實驗一不僅僅是學習數據建模與SQL查詢的過程,更是理解數據如何在實際應用中發揮作用的關鍵。通過這些實驗,學生可以掌握如何設計一個有效的數據庫,並能夠使用SQL進行數據操作,這對於未來的職業生涯是非常有幫助的。

此外,隨著雲計算和大數據技術的發展,數據庫的管理和操作變得更加複雜。掌握數據建模和SQL查詢的基本技能,將使學生在這個快速變化的領域中保持競爭力。

總結

南郵數據庫實驗一提供了一個良好的平台,讓學生能夠深入了解數據建模與SQL查詢的基本概念和實踐。這些技能不僅對於學術研究有幫助,也對於未來的職業發展至關重要。若您對於數據庫管理有進一步的需求,考慮使用香港VPS來搭建您的數據庫環境,這將為您的學習和實踐提供更多的支持。